  # stylus-loader
  A [stylus](http://learnboost.github.io/stylus/) loader for [webpack](https://github.com/webpack/webpack).
  
  [![build status](https://secure.travis-ci.org/shama/stylus-loader.svg)](https://travis-ci.org/shama/stylus-loader)
  [![NPM version](https://badge.fury.io/js/stylus-loader.svg)](https://badge.fury.io/js/stylus-loader)
  
  ## Install
  
  `npm install stylus-loader stylus --save-dev`
  
  **Important**: in order to have ability use any `stylus` package version,
  it won't be installed automatically. So it's required to
  add it to `package.json` along with `stylus-loader`.
  
  The latest version supporting webpack 1 can be installed with:
  
  `npm install stylus-loader@webpack1 stylus --save-dev`
  
  ## Usage
  
  ```js
  var css = require('!raw!stylus!./file.styl'); // Just the CSS
  var css = require('!css!stylus!./file.styl'); // CSS with processed url(...)s
  ```
  
  See [css-loader](https://github.com/webpack/css-loader) to see the effect of processed `url(...)`s.
  
  Or within the webpack config:
  
  ```js
  module: {
    loaders: [{
      test: /\.styl$/,
      loader: 'css-loader!stylus-loader?paths=node_modules/bootstrap-stylus/stylus/'
    }]
  }
  ```
  
  Then you can: `var css = require('./file.styl');`.
  
  Use in tandem with the [style-loader](https://github.com/webpack/style-loader) to add the css rules to your `document`:
  
  ```js
  module: {
    loaders: [
      { test: /\.styl$/, loader: 'style-loader!css-loader!stylus-loader' }
    ]
  }
  ```
  
  and then `require('./file.styl');` will compile and add the CSS to your page.
  
  `stylus-loader` can also take advantage of webpack's resolve options. With the default options it'll find files in `web_modules` as well as `node_modules`, make sure to prefix any lookup in node_modules with `~`. For example if you have a styles package lookup files in it like `@import '~styles/my-styles`. It can also find stylus files without having the extension specified in the `@import` and index files in folders if webpack is configured for stylus's file extension.
  
  ```js
  module: {
    resolve: {
      extensions: ['', '.js', '.styl']
    }
  }
  ```
  
  will let you have an `index.styl` file in your styles package and `require('styles')` or `@import '~styles'` it. It also lets you load a stylus file from a package installed in node_modules or if you add a modulesDirectories, like `modulesDirectories: ['node_modules', 'web_modules', 'bower_components']` option you could load from a folder like bower_components. To load files from a relative path leave off the `~` and `@import 'relative-styles/my-styles';` it.
  
  Be careful though not to use the extensions configuration for two types of in one folder. If a folder has a `index.js` and a `index.styl` and you `@import './that-folder'`, it'll end up importing a javascript file into your stylus.
  
  ### Stylus Plugins
  
  You can also use stylus plugins by adding an extra `stylus` section to your `webpack.config.js`.
  
  ```js
  var stylus_plugin = require('stylus_plugin');
  module: {
    loaders: [
      { test: /\.styl$/, loader: 'style-loader!css-loader!stylus-loader' }
    ]
  },
  stylus: {
    use: [stylus_plugin()]
  }
  ```
  
  Multiple configs can be used by giving other configs different names and referring to the with the `config` query option.
  
  
  ```js
  var stylus_plugin = require('stylus_plugin');
  module: {
    loaders: [
      {
        test: /\.other\.styl$/,
        loader: 'style-loader!css-loader!stylus-loader?config=stylusOther'
      }
    ]
  },
  stylusOther: {
    use: [stylus_plugin()]
  }
  ```
  
  #### Webpack 2
  
  Webpack 2 formalizes its options with a schema. Options can be provided to `stylus-loader` in the options field to `module.rules` or through LoaderOptionsPlugin or `stylus-loader`'s OptionsPlugin (a convenience wrapper around LoaderOptionsPlugin).
  
  Config through module rules:
  
  ```js
  module: {
    rules: [
      {
        test: /\.styl$/,
        use: [
          'style-loader',
          'css-loader',
          {
            loader: 'stylus-loader',
            options: {
              use: [stylus_plugin()],
            },
          },
        ],
      }
    ],
  },
  ```
  
  Config through LoaderOptionsPlugin:
  
  ```js
  module: {
    rules: [
      {
        test: /\.styl$/,
        loader: 'style-loader!css-loader!stylus-loader',
      },
    ],
  },
  plugins: [
    new webpack.LoaderOptionsPlugin({
      test: /\.styl$/,
      stylus: {
        // You can have multiple stylus configs with other names and use them
        // with `stylus-loader?config=otherConfig`.
        default: {
          use: [stylus_plugin()],
        },
        otherConfig: {
          use: [other_plugin()],
        },
      },
    }),
  ],
  ```
  
  Config through `stylus-loader`'s OptionsPlugin (convenience wrapper for LoaderOptionsPlugin):
  
  ```js
  plugins: [
    new stylusLoader.OptionsPlugin({
      default: {
        use: [stylus_plugin()],
      },
    }),
  ],
  ```
  
  #### Using nib with stylus
  
  The easiest way of enabling `nib` is to import it in the stylus options:
  
  ```js
  stylus: {
    use: [require('nib')()],
    import: ['~nib/lib/nib/index.styl']
  }
  ```
  
  where `~` resolves to `node_modules/`
  
  ### Prefer webpack resolving
  
  `stylus-loader` currently prefers resolving paths with stylus's resovling utilities and then falling back to webpack when it can't find files. Use the `preferPathResolver` option with the value `'webpack'` to swap this. This has the benefit of using webpack's async resolving instead of stylus's sync resolving. If you have a lot of dependencies in your stylus files this'll let those dependencies be found in parallel.
  
  ```js
  stylus: {
    preferPathResolver: 'webpack',
  }
  ```
